WebThe Children’s Health Insurance Program (CHIP) is a joint federal and state program that provides health coverage to uninsured children in families with incomes too high to qualify for Medicaid, but too low to afford private coverage. Alabama ALL Kids covers uninsured children in families with moderate incomes that are too high to qualify for Medicaid.
